Course Content

• Fundamentals of Nanotechnology for Energy Applications
• Nanomaterials for Solar Cells (Silicon Nanowires, Quantum Dots)
• Nanofluidics for Enhanced Heat Transfer and Energy Efficiency
• Nanoscale Characterization Techniques for Power Generation Devices (SEM, TEM, AFM)
• Nanostructured Catalysts for Fuel Cells and Electrolysis
• Advanced Battery Technologies: Nanomaterials for Improved Performance and Capacity
• Nanotechnology in Thermoelectric Power Generation
• Modeling and Simulation of Nanoscale Energy Devices
